Women of childbearing age are more likely to develop autoimmune diseases than men of a similar age.

There is a chronicle and multi system autoimmune disease that affect mostly women of childbearing, systemic lupus erythematosus affects the autoimmunity during pregnancy. This disease can affect the sking, heart, brain, kidneys, even the lungs. Basically, systemic lupus erythematosus affects connective tissues, inflaming them.
